Engenheiro de Software Mobile Júnior (Android/iOS)
iFood.com
Office
Brasil
Full Time
Nosso Modo De Fazer No Time:
Transforme sua carreira com o iFood! Somos uma empresa brasileira de tecnologia referência na América Latina. Por meio de soluções inovadoras, conectamos milhares de restaurantes a milhões de consumidores diariamente com uma média de 100 milhões de pedidos mensais. Além do delivery de comida, também somos Mercado, Farmácia e Pet. Temos também o iFood Pago, nossa Fintech, que engloba o iFood Benefícios, o vale alimentação e refeição do iFood e o próprio iFood Pago, o banco do restaurante. Junte-se a nós e faça parte de uma equipe que está sempre à frente com tecnologia de ponta e inovação constante.
Seu CardáPio DiáRio:
- Conhecimento em desenvolvimento e arquitetura de aplicações mobile em Android (Kotlin/Java/Flutter) e/ou iOS (Swift/Objective-C/Flutter).
- Conhecimento em desenvolvimento de build mobile em Fastlane, Gradle, Groovy, KotlinDSL, XcodeTools e/ou Buck.
- Conhecimento em autenticação, autorização, armazenamento seguro.
- Conhecimento em desenvolvimento de SDK’s para aplicativos mobile utilizando tecnologias como Rust, C/C++, Kotlin, Swift, Objetive-C.
- Compreensão e uso de ciclo de vida de desenvolvimento de software (SDLC) e desenvolvimento seguro (SDL).
Ingredientes Que Buscamos:
- Conhecimento em desenvolvimento em jobs para pipeline (Gitlab Pipelines, Github Actions, Jenkins Pipeline).
- Conhecimento em desenvolvimento e arquitetura de aplicações como serviços, APIs e/ou client desktop, em alguma das linguagens a seguir: Rust, C/C++, Kotlin/Java, Python, Go, Flutter e/ou Ruby.
- Conhecimento em pentest de aplicativos mobile.
- Conhecimento em criação de módulos para Xposed, Magisk, Frida e/ou Cydia.
- Conhecimento de vulnerabilidades de memória.
- Conhecimento com operações criptográficas.
Para RealçAr O Sabor:
- Conhecimento em engenharia reversa de aplicativos mobile Android e/ou iOS.
- Conhecimento e mitigações das vulnerabilidades mais comuns de aplicativos mobile, como OWASP Mobile Top 10, MASTG, MASVS.
- Conhecimento sobre melhores práticas de segurança para aplicativos mobile.
- Prática na criação de soluções de segurança para resolver problemas de mobile security.
- Experiência com rooting e/ou jailbreak.
- Experiência com uso e desenvolvimento de ferramentas para análise de aplicativos mobile (SAST e DAST).
- Participação em conferências, workshops e cursos de segurança.
Buscamos uma pessoa apaixonada por inovação e educação tecnológica, que esteja sempre em busca de novos aprendizados e que goste de desafios. Se você se identifica com este perfil, adoraríamos conhecer você!
Engenheiro de Software Mobile Júnior (Android/iOS)
Office
Brasil
Full Time
October 8, 2025